Hi there,

I have been monitoring Cisco 7507, Catalyst 2926, and Catalyst 2916M-XL by
CiscoWorks and CWSI on NNM 5.0.1.
When I open the event browser, I can see the trap every 2 minuets from
2916M-XL. The trap said "TCP connection has been terminated.
(tcpConnectionClose Trap) tsLineUser:". As a result my investigating by
Sniffer, it seems that the manager tried to access 2916 by HTTP periodically.
(I am not sure whether it is from CiscoWorks or NNM.)

Does anyone know how to stop it?

The culprit would likely be OV's HTTP discovery. Disable it there.
